Sunday 1 March 2009

Highlights:
4 Smew around today, including a drake and redhead on Heronry South still, viewable from the Hayden Hide. Two Firecrests continue to frequent the area around the Beach at the south end of Cloudy Pit and a Chiffchaff was heard singing nearby. 3 Little Egrets, 4 Pintail (1 drake) and 2 Red-crested Pochards (1 drake) were also noted.

Other sightings: 12 Shelduck, 2 Water Rails, 4+ Oystercatchers, 6 Ringed Plover, 16 Golden Plover, Woodcock, 4 Redshank, Green Sandpiper, Grey Wagtail.
